Aquatics Therapy Assistant

Location: Lewes

Salary: A£21,294 – A£22,764 per annum, depending on experience

Hours : 32.5 hours per week

Working Pattern : Shifts 8am – 8pm, Weekend work is required on a rota basis

The Role

The organisation are looking for a confident swimmer with a calm, caring approach to join them as an Aquatics Therapy Assistant. You’ll be part of a supportive, person-centred team delivering aquatic therapy sessions that build strength, improve movement, and bring joy to the children and young people at Foundation.

This is an active, collaborative role – ideal for someone who enjoys working closely with others and using movement and interaction to support individual goals.

At the Foundation, you’ll be part of a vibrant, inclusive team supporting children and young adults with complex disabilities to thrive.

This is more than a poolside role-it’s a chance to be part of something meaningful, every day, surrounded by colleagues who value teamwork, trust and getting it right.

Key Responsibilities

* Facilitating aquatic therapy planned by their on-site NHS physiotherapists
* Supporting children and young adults with complex physical needs in the water
* Creating a safe, welcoming, and inclusive environment for all
* Monitoring progress and recording outcomes in line with their Aquatics Curriculum
* Collaborating with care, education, and physio teams
* Help deliver land-based movement sessions when not poolside
* Supporting pool operations and maintaining high health and safety standards

Skills and Qualifications

* A confident swimmer with the ability to meet National Pool Lifeguard Qualification (NPLQ) standards
* NPLQ certified, or willing to train (they’ll cover the cost)
* Experience supporting people with disabilities or complex needs
* GCSEs (Grade C/4 or above) or equivalent in English and Maths
* Calm, proactive and team-focused
* A passion for aquatics and helping others achieve their potential

Desirable

* ASA/STA Level 1 or 2 in Teaching Aquatics
* Experience in a leisure, swimming or therapy setting
* Understanding of hydrotherapy or adapted physical activity
